Ring chromosome 20 (r(20)) syndrome is a
rare disease
characterized by refractory epilepsy, moderate mental retardation and particular electroencephalographic disorder with non-convulsive
status epilepticus
. Here, we report a new case of r(20) syndrome in a 12 year old female who presented minimal dysmorphism, generalised tonic-clonic and absence seizures refractory to medical therapy and behavioural troubles. Among 20 cytogenetically analysed cells, 14 (70%) exhibited a 46,XX,r(20)(p13q13.3) karyotype and 6 (30%) showed a normal 46,XX caryotype. Interphasic FISH using centromeric probe of chromosome 20 detects the presence of a chromosome 20 monosomy in 7% and a duplicated ring chromosome 20 in 8% of studied cells. Metaphase FISH using chromosome 20 telomeric probes and specific probes of CHRNA4 and KCNQ2 genes detects the absence of any deletion in the ring chromosome 20. Clinical symptoms of r(20) syndrome are attributed to telomeric partial monosomy generated by ring chromosome and causing an haploinsufficiency of two epilepsy genes CHRNA4 and KCNQ2. However, our patient presents the typical epilepsy disorder but no detectable deletion in the ring chromosome 20. We speculate that clinical features of ring chromosome 20 syndrome are caused by low mosaicism of chromosome 20 monosomy caused by the loss of the ring chromosome 20.

Intravascular lymphoma (IVL) is a
rare disease
form of malignant lymphoma, and it is characterised by the selective growth of lymphoma cells within the lumina of vessels. Identification of this disease at an early stage is difficult because of non-specific clinical symptoms and neuroradiological findings. Most reported IVL cases are diagnosed at post-mortem following autopsy. We report the case of a patient who presented with
status epilepticus
(SE) as the initial manifestation of IVL. Despite the administration of anti-convulsant agents and general care the patient's condition deteriorated rapidly after admission, culminating in death due to respiratory failure and heart failure 21 days after the onset of symptoms. Post-mortem examination revealed IVL in the brain and multiple organs. Epileptic seizures often appear during the clinical course of IVL; however, they occur most frequently at advanced stages. Diagnosis of IVL that first presents with SE is of clinical importance because the treatment and prognosis of acute SE arising from IVL are different from those of SE originating from other causes.

Severe myoclonic epilepsy in infancy (SMEI) is a
rare disease
, characterized by febrile and afebrile, generalized and unilateral, clonic or tonic-clonic seizures that occur in the first year of life in an otherwise apparently normal infant. They are later associated with myoclonus, atypical absences, and partial seizures. Developmental delay becomes apparent within the second year of life and is followed by definite cognitive impairment and personality disorders of variable intensity. In the borderline form, children do not present with myoclonic symptoms but have the same general picture. SMEI is a channelopathy and the genetic studies have shown a mutation in the SCN1A gene in 70 to 80% of the patients, including the borderline forms. At present, there are no well-established correlations between genotype and phenotype. The electroencephalograms, often normal at the onset, display both generalized and focal anomalies, without a specific electroencephalographic pattern. As a rule, neuroimaging is normal. All seizure types are resistant to antiepileptic drugs and
status epilepticus
is frequent. Some drugs have been shown to aggravate the seizures and must be avoided. Two recent drugs have been proved to partially control the convulsive seizures and the
status epilepticus
. Therefore, it is crucial to diagnose this epilepsy soon after its onset in order to prescribe the most appropriate treatment.

Hemophagocytic lymphohistiocytosis (HLH) is a
rare disease
resulting in clinical and biochemical manifestations of extreme inflammation. Myelodysplastic syndrome (MDS) represents a heterogenous group of clonal hematopoietic disorders. The development of MDS is common in children with trisomy of chromosome 8. Here, we report a fatal case of 8-year-old girl who was admitted to the emergency department with
status epilepticus
, and later diagnosed with HLH associated with MDS and trisomy of chromosome 8. We believe this is the first reported case of HLH associated with MDS and trisomy 8 in a pediatric patient.

Dravet syndrome, also known as severe myoclonic epilepsy in infancy, is a
rare disease
characterized by the appearance of different types of seizures in a healthy baby, triggered by various factors and stressful events. We report 8 Lebanese cases referred for molecular analysis of the
SCN1A
gene. Results were positive in 7 cases and revealed de novo variants at the heterozygous state in different exons of the gene for all except one, where the variant was intronic. Four variants were novel. Confirmation of Dravet syndrome is important for a better follow-up and treatment, preventing the occurrence of
status epilepticus
and severe neurological deterioration.

Febrile infection-related epilepsy syndrome (FIRES) is an intractable neurological disease characterized by an unexplained refractory
status epilepticus
triggered by febrile infection. A Consensus definition of FIRES was proposed in 2018, and its clinical features and prognosis are gradually being clarified. However, the development of effective treatments has been hindered as the etiology of this
rare disease
is as yet unelucidated. The basic approach to the management of FIRES, like other forms of epilepsy, is based on the control of seizures, however seizures are extremely intractable and require intravenous administration of large doses of anticonvulsants, mainly barbiturates. This treatment strategy produces various complications including respiratory depression and drug hypersensitivity syndrome, which make it more difficult to control seizures. Consequently, it is crucial to predict these events and to formulate a planned treatment strategy. As well, it is important to grow out of conventional treatment strategies that rely on only anticonvulsants, and alternative therapies are gradually being developed. One such example is the adoption of a ketogenic diet which may lead to reduced convulsions as well as improve intellectual prognosis. Further, overproduction of inflammatory cytokines in the central nervous system has been shown to be strongly related to the pathology of FIRES which has led to attempts at immunomodulation therapy including anti-cytokine therapy.

Fahr's disease is a
rare disease
in which there is symmetrical bilateral intracranial calcification. We are presenting a 50-year-old female patient who presented with
status epilepticus
. She had history of generalized tonic clonic fits for the last fifteen years. Her CT scan revealed widespread bilateral and symmetrical intracranial calcification in cerebellum, thalamus, basal ganglia and in white matter of the cerebral hemisphere Most of the secondary causes were ruled out to make the clinical diagnosis of Fahr's disease.
